Question : Select the most appropriate word to fill in the blank.
______ there were no buses, we had to take a taxi.
Option 1: Even if
Option 2: Hence
Option 3: Although
Option 4: Since
Correct Answer: Since
Solution : The correct choice is the fourth option.
Since is the appropriate word to fill in the blank. The word "since" is used to indicate a cause-and-effect relationship or a reason. It suggests that due to the absence of buses, the speaker had to take a taxi.
